Why Buy a Chest Freezer?

If you're cooking in batches for your family or preparing your own vegetables on the allotment a chest freezer can provide an abundance of storage space. They're great for the garage or the utility room and are ideal if you have limited kitchen space for refrigerator freezers.

Some come with a strong basket that is attached to the top to keep food from falling. These are usually equipped with digital temperature gauges and high-temperature alarms to help keep food fresher longer.

Chest freezers are available in a variety of sizes. Smaller models can hold 99 cubic litres, while larger models can hold up to 297. A small family could get by with a model that is this big, however larger families will need to go for a larger one.

As the name implies, chest freezers are taller and lower than upright freezers. As a result, they require less floor space. Some models can be placed inside a house, whereas others are positioned in an outbuilding such as a shed or garage. If you are planning to store your freezer in a location that is not heated, ensure it can function at low temperatures.

Another factor to consider is how simple it will be to get food items stored in the freezer. A lot of models have storage bins at the top. This makes it easier to rummage and find things, without the need to empty the entire contents. Other useful features include a lid that is balanced and remains in its place when you open it and an inside light for clear visibility.

Be sure to purchase an appliance that is energy efficient. To save money on electricity it should have an energy efficiency rating of A++ or higher. Refrigerators and fridges comprise 17% of household energy consumption. Selecting a model that is efficient can help you save money over time.

Cleaning your chest freezer doesn't have to be a burden. With a few simple tips, you can make it effortless.

Make sure that your freezer is empty prior to cleaning it. The drawers must be cleaned in soapy, hot water. Rinse them thoroughly. Utilize disinfectants to clean the compartments and let them completely dry. After cleaning the drawers using hot water, use a moist cloth to clean the chest freezer most energy efficient inside surface. This will sanitize and remove any undesirable residues or stains.

Separate items that emit strong odours from other foods. This will prevent the odours to transfer to other items stored in the freezer.
